Quinquagesima Sunday: Sunday, Feb 22 Palm Sunday: Sunday, Apr 5 Maundy Thursday: Thursday, Apr 9 Good Friday: Friday, Apr 10 Easter Day: Sunday, Apr 12 Easter Monday: Monday, Apr 13 Prayer Day: Friday, May 8 Ascension Day: Thursday, May 21 Whitsunday: Sunday, May 31 Whitmonday: Monday, Jun 1 New Year's Day: Thursday, Jan 1 Valentine's Day: Saturday, Feb 14 Daylight Saving begins: Sunday, Mar 29 Mother's Day: Sunday, May 10 Constitution Day: Friday, Jun 5 Father's Day: Friday, Jun 5 Autumn holiday week begins: Monday, Oct 12 Daylight Saving ends: Sunday, Oct 25 Halloween: Saturday, Oct 31 All Saints' Sunday: Sunday, Nov 1 1st Sunday in Advent: Sunday, Nov 29 Christmas Day: Friday, Dec 25 Boxing Day: Saturday, Dec 26 New Year's Eve: Thursday, Dec 31

When is Christmas celebrated in denmark?

It is celebrated on the 24th (christmas eve). In Demark you receive the presents in the evening, not the morning after. 25th and 26th are commonly just considered bank holidays.
